WebAug 20, 2024 · Please note, there is no maximum penalty period. The state in which you reside has an average monthly cost of $4,000 for nursing home care and you gifted $60,000 during the look-back period. This means you will be ineligible for Medicaid for 15 months ($60,000 gifted divided by $4,000 average monthly cost = 15 months). WebOct 9, 2024 · The surviving spouse needs to indicate on the tax return that their spouse is deceased. According to the Internal Revenue Service, the surviving spouse should write this notation above the area on the return where the address is entered. The notation should state the word “DECEASED,” the deceased spouse’s name, and the date of death.
WebFeb 27, 2024 · In 2024, this Spousal Impoverishment Rule allows the community spouse (the non-applicant spouse) to retain 50% of the couple’s assets, up to a maximum of $148,620. If the non-applicant’s share of the assets falls under $29,724, 100% of the assets, up to $29,724 can be kept by the non-applicant. Medicaid’s Look-Back Rule.
